Mindworks expects more than 20,000 visitors in its first year and aims to position itself among Chicago’s can’t-miss destinations and as a place for visitors from around the world to better understand how behavioral scientists do their work, the insights from their research, and how to translate their discoveries into everyday interventions that can help people design their best lives. The Center for Decision Research (CDR) at the University of Chicago Booth School of Business announces the opening of Mindworks: The Science of Thinking, the world’s first lab and interactive museum dedicated to behavioral science, located at 224 S Michigan Avenue in the heart of Chicago’s cultural corridor.
